The President of the Irish Natura and Hill Farmers’ Association (INHFA) has called for changes on the classification of wool. Pheilim Molloy urged Irish MEPs and the European Parliament to once again push the European Commission on the reclassification of wool. “Currently wool is classified as category 3 animal waste product under EU Regulation 1069/2009 […] The post INHFA urges changes on classification of wool appeared first on Agriland.ie.
